Oh my gosh, you guys, have you heard about Raji Ashok Free Rides? There’s this amazing lady in Chennai, Tamil Nadu, named Raji Ashok, and she’s like the coolest auto-rickshaw driver ever! She’s 50 years old and has been driving her auto for 23 years, but what makes her super special is that she gives free rides to women, elderly people, and girl students after 10 p.m. How awesome is that? She even takes people to the hospital for free if it’s an emergency! I saw her story online, and it totally made my day.

Raji’s from Kerala and moved to Chennai with her husband, who’s also an auto driver. She’s got a college degree in Philosophy, which is so cool, but she couldn’t find a job when she came to Chennai. That must’ve been really tough, right? So, she decided to drive an auto to help her family. Imagine being a woman driving an auto 23 years ago when it was mostly guys doing it! She’s like a superhero breaking all the rules. She faced a lot of challenges, like people not taking her seriously at first, but she kept going.
What I love most is how Raji cares about making women feel safe. She never says no to a woman who needs a ride, even if it’s super late. She just asks for an hour’s notice so she can plan her trips. Her auto has a toll-free number on it, so anyone can call her. She’s helped over 10,000 women travel safely, which is like, whoa, a huge number! She also gives out water, biscuits, and even sanitary napkins to people who need them. That’s so kind
Raji doesn’t just stop at free rides. She teaches women how to drive autos for free! She says lots of women work as maids for super low pay, but driving an auto can earn them 15,000 to 20,000 rupees a month. That’s a big deal! She wants women to be strong and independent, and I think that’s the best thing ever. She even teaches them in her own auto without charging for gas.
